In a socially diverse sample of 206 infant–mother pairs, we investigated predictors of infants’ attachment security at 15 months, with a particular emphasis on mothers’ tendency to comment appropriately or in a non‐attuned manner on their 8‐month‐olds’ internal states (so‐called mind‐mindedness). Multinomial logistic regression analyses showed that higher scores for appropriate mind‐related comments and lower scores for non‐attuned mind‐related comments distinguished secure‐group mothers from their counterparts in the insecure‐avoidant, insecure‐resistant, and insecure‐disorganized groups. Higher scores for appropriate mind‐related comments and lower scores for non‐attuned mind‐related comments also independently predicted dichotomous organized/disorganized attachment. General maternal sensitivity predicted neither attachment security nor organization, although sensitivity was found to relate to dichotomous secure/insecure attachment specifically in the context of low socioeconomic status. The findings highlight how appropriate and non‐attuned mind‐related comments make independent contributions to attachment and suggest that mind‐mindedness is best characterized as a multidimensional construct.
Responses to an unfamiliar adult were examined in infants of mothers with social phobia (N= 79) and infants of nonanxious comparison mothers (N= 77) at 10 and 14 months in a social referencing paradigm. On each occasion, a female stranger first interacted with the mother and then approached and interacted with the infant. Over time, infants of mothers with social phobia showed increasing avoidance of the stranger, particularly when they were behaviorally inhibited. In boys, maternal social phobia was associated with increasing fearful responses. Infant avoidance was predicted by expressed maternal anxiety and low levels of encouragement to interact with the stranger. The findings are discussed in relation to theories concerning the intergenerational transmission of social anxiety.
Over the last two decades, it has been established that children's emotion understanding changes as they develop. Recent studies have also begun to address individual differences in children's emotion understanding. The first goal of this study was to examine the development of these individual differences across a wide age range with a test assessing nine different components of emotion understanding. The second goal was to examine the relation between language ability and individual differences in emotion understanding. Eighty children ranging in age from 4 to 11 years were tested. Children displayed a clear improvement with age in both their emotion understanding and language ability. In each age group, there were clear individual differences in emotion understanding and language ability. Age and language ability together explained 72% of emotion understanding variance; 20% of this variance was explained by age alone and 27% by language ability alone. The results are discussed in terms of their theoretical and practical implications.
BackgroundThe new Australian 24-Hour Movement Guidelines for the Early Years recommend that, for preschoolers, a healthy 24-h includes: i) ≥180 min of physical activity, including ≥60 min of energetic play, ii) ≤1 h of sedentary screen time, and iii) 10–13 h of good quality sleep. Using an Australian sample, this study reports the proportion of preschool children meeting these guidelines and investigates associations with social-cognitive development.MethodsData from 248 preschool children (mean age = 4.2 ± 0.6 years, 57% boys) participating in the PATH-ABC study were analyzed. Children completed direct assessments of physical activity (accelerometry) and social cognition (the Test of Emotional Comprehension (TEC) and Theory of Mind (ToM)). Parents reported on children’s screen time and sleep. Children were categorised as meeting/not meeting: i) individual guidelines, ii) combinations of two guidelines, or iii) all three guidelines. Associations were examined using linear regression adjusting for child age, sex, vocabulary, area level socio-economic status and childcare level clustering.ResultsHigh proportions of children met the physical activity (93.1%) and sleep (88.7%) guidelines, whereas fewer met the screen time guideline (17.3%). Overall, 14.9% of children met all three guidelines. Children meeting the sleep guideline performed better on TEC than those who did not (mean difference [MD] = 1.41; 95% confidence interval (CI) = 0.36, 2.47). Children meeting the sleep and physical activity or sleep and screen time guidelines also performed better on TEC (MD = 1.36; 95% CI = 0.31, 2.41) and ToM (MD = 0.25; 95% CI = −0.002, 0.50; p = 0.05), respectively, than those who did not. Meeting all three guidelines was associated with better ToM performance (MD = 0.28; 95% CI = −0.002, 0.48, p = 0.05), while meeting a larger number of guidelines was associated with better TEC (3 or 2 vs. 1/none, p < 0.02) and ToM performance (3 vs. 2, p = 0.03).ConclusionsStrategies to promote adherence to the 24-Hour Movement Behaviour Guidelines for the Early Years among preschool children are warranted. Supporting preschool children to meet all guidelines or more guidelines, particularly the sleep and screen time guidelines, may be beneficial for their social-cognitive development.
Relations among indices of maternal mind‐mindedness (appropriate and nonattuned mind‐related comments) and children's: (a) internal state vocabulary and perspectival symbolic play at 26 months (N = 206), and (b) theory of mind (ToM) at 51 months (n = 161) were investigated. Appropriate comments were positively associated with ToM, but were unrelated to internal state language and perspectival symbolic play. Nonattuned comments were negatively correlated with internal state language and perspectival symbolic play, but were unrelated to ToM. Path analyses indicated that the best fit model assumed: (a) indirect links between nonattuned comments and ToM via children's perspectival symbolic play, (b) a direct link between appropriate comments and ToM, and (c) an indirect link between appropriate comments and ToM via children's concurrent receptive verbal ability.
